Buyer/Expediter 

Position Summary
Reports to and receives operational direction from Procurement Management. Receives functional guidance form the global business unit Purchasing Manager. Performs tasks involved in the formation, administration/expediting, and delivery of purchase orders. Communicates with suppliers and personnel within company to establish clear definition of requirements and to assure performance to purchase order terms and conditions. Prepares bidder pre-qualification, bidder lists, bid solicitation, bid analysis, makes commitments and administers purchase orders.

Responsibilities
Forms and issues purchase orders by performing the following:
•Prepares bidders’lists.
•Prequalifies bidders.
•Forms bid packages.
•Issues bid requests.
•Coordinates bidders’questions.
•Receives bids.
•Prepares Commercial Bid Summary and recommendation letter.
•Recommends and secures approvals in accordance with established procedures.
•Prepares and commits order.
•Prepares and maintains control and status reporting documents.
•Administers and expedites assigned purchase orders, performing the following functions:
•Establishes files and controls for all outgoing and incoming correspondence on each assigned order.
•Monitors supplier performance for conformance to commercial terms.
•Monitors activities by Engineering and other in-house functions to ensure compliance with the order terms.
•Initiates follow-up actions with the supplier or in-house functional group to ensure performance in accordance with contract terms and conditions.
•Informs or works with other project Procurement personnel as assigned to the administration of the order.
•Expedites all deliverables including schedules, engineering submittals, material, equipment, and other documentation requirements.
•Analyzes and distributes those suppliers’reports specified in the order/contract.
•Communicates with suppliers as necessary to achieve required service and results from potential and actual suppliers to meet project needs.
•Communicates with Engineering to assist and/or guide them in the preparation of material requisitions for the procurement of materials and equipment and to achieve the understanding needed to process these requisitions.
